#a8795e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a8795e is composed of 65.9% red, 47.5%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28% magenta, 44%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 21.9 degrees, a saturation of 29.8% and a lightness of 51.4%. #a8795e color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2bc with #510000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#a8795e color description : Mostly desaturated dark orange.

#a8795e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a8795e has RGB values of R:168, G:121,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.44,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 11041118.

Shades and Tints of #a8795e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050302 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a8795e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b817b is the less saturated color, while #fe6208 is the most saturated one.
